Description
NE coast of Unalaska I., Aleution Islands.
History
Aleut name published by Lieutenant Sarichev (1826, map 15), Imperial Russian Navy (IRN), as "M(ys) Kalekhta" or "Cape Kalekhta." Lutke (1836, p. 281) reported that the natives called it "Igognak." It was called "Priest Point" by U.S. Bureau of Fisheries (USBF) in 1888.
